Though it is one of the most common causes of death in epilepsy patients, SUDEP is still infrequently and even reluctantly named on autopsy reports.
Expanding on the 1990 book Epilepsy and Sudden Death, edited by Lathers and Schraeder.
Sudden Unexpected Death in Epilepsy Forensic and Clinical Issues reviews the basic science of epilepsy as it relates to SUDEP.
Adopting a global, multidisciplinary focus to address the mystery of SUDEP, this important work provides clinicians, researchers, patients and families with the knowledge to freely discuss the phenomenon and thereby discover the preventive treatment regimes to decrease the occurrence of SUDEP.
Jane Hanna and Dr Rosie Panelli have contributed on the challenges in overcoming ethical and legal communication barriers in SUDEP.
